The whole thread is about using a mage pet as a damage sponge. There are a lot of people who don’t raid much or at all. As a generic DPS and utility player for 1-2 group stuff mages are great. Grinding, farming, epic fights, etc.

For raiding, Cothing and rods are important unless we change to unrooted dragons or are required to crawl. A warmbody main mage is still better than half the classes that show up on raids. Situationally, DA training extremely important.
